Pick Your Shelter Design



The centerpiece of any kind of glamping setup is the framework itself. This is where you set the tone for your whole experience, so select something that blends comfort with personality.

Bell Tents



Bell tents are the timeless glamping option forever reason. Their sizable round impact and tall facility pole enable actual furniture-- assume beds, rugs, and side tables-- without feeling confined. Canvas material maintains the indoor breathable in summertime and remarkably warm on amazing evenings. A quality 5-meter bell outdoor tents can comfortably sleep 2 adults with space to spare for decoration.

Geodesic Domes



For something more remarkable, a geodesic dome supplies a futuristic visual with incredible structural stamina. Numerous featured transparent panels, transforming the ceiling right into a live stargazing home window. They stand up well in wind and rain, making them a wise lasting financial investment if you prepare to utilize your glamping configuration throughout multiple periods.

High-end Safari Tents



If you want to go for it, platform-mounted safari camping tents bring true store resort energy to your backyard. Raised wooden decks, zip-out walls, and covered decks make these feeling less like outdoor camping and more like a private villa-- just with better air.

Produce a Bed Well Worth Oversleeping



Absolutely nothing divides glamping from camping faster than the sleeping scenario. Ditch the resting bag and invest in a proper bed framework or an elevated cot with a thick cushion topper. Layer it with hotel-quality linen, a chunky knit toss, and at the very least three pillows per person. Add a battery-powered bedside lamp and a little tray with publications or a candle for that finishing shop touch. Your visitors-- or you-- should feel like taking a look at in the early morning is truly difficult.

Set the Mood with Lighting and Design



Illumination is the solitary most effective device in your glamping toolkit. String cozy Edison light bulb fairy lights throughout the camping tent ceiling, cover them around neighboring trees, and line paths with solar-powered lights. Inside the outdoor tents, mix flooring lanterns with column candle lights (use flameless LED variations for security) to develop layers of warm, golden light that really feel enchanting after dark.

Construct a Cozy Outdoor Living Location



A real deluxe glamping experience expands past the tent. Create an outdoor lounge location with weatherproof elbow chairs or a seat, a reduced coffee table, and a fire pit or chiminea as the centerpiece. Border the area with potted lavender or rosemary for fragrance, and add a few outdoor-safe toss coverings curtained over the seating for freezing nights.

If your budget plan enables, a little wooden deck adjacent to the outdoor tents boosts the whole configuration and keeps mud at bay during damp climate. Also a collection of stepping stones and a simple outside rug can specify the room without major construction.
